Template:Minigame-infobox Stompbot XL is a single-player minigame found in Mario Party Advance.

Introduction

The player is sitting in place in their robot as the lava waves crash behind them.

Gameplay

The player, with three hearts as health, has to use the titular vehicle to drive around obstacles such as lava, rocks, and bridges (only in Free Play) to outrun the crashing lava waves approaching from behind. If a player goes over some leftover lava, he or she loses a heart, and the speed on the vehicle decreases. There are some health kits on the ground that heal the player by one or two hearts. In Shroom City, the player wins by reaching the goal. In Free Play, the player can score by outrunning the crashing lava waves for as long as possible before being caught.

In-Game Text

  • Rules: "Steer your robo-boots while avoiding rocks and lava. Don't get burned!"
